Transaction ecd402c788c1815e5e5710aaf9446b8e030a9a7f2a67932d62901073a1ea9edc

block
ebc6dcbea6247d1789b7b50ddbabbb86f60613192fa5e3fe16efd4165a8db591

1 Input

101 Outputs